Product (RED) is a program where if you buy a (RED) product, a percentage of the sale will go
towards curing HIV/AIDS in Africa. The latest (RED) product is from Converse which teamed up with trend setter Hiroshi Fujiwara on a Chuck Talyor Low in a simple red colourway. One of HF's many popular logos is tagged on the back of the show. Retailed at S$300.
